Agrawal Order on Board 1 7 /0 2 /201 (1) The accused/applicant has moved this bail application under Section 439 of the Code of Criminal Procedure for releasing him on regular bail during trial in connection with Crime No. 573/2015 registered at Police Station Civil Lines, Distt. Bilaspur for the offences punishable under Sections 452, 294, 323, 506, 325, 458 & 459/34 of Indian Penal Code. (2) Case of the prosecution, in brief, is that on 21.09.2015 applicant & two other co-accused persons assaulted one Raju Khande in the night and thereby committed the aforesaid offences.
(3) Counsel for the applicant submits that initially the applicant was granted by the trial Court and at the time of filing of charge offfences, offences under Sections 458 & 459 of the IPC has also
been added and, therefore, he has been arrested again. He further submits that similarly situated co-accused Rajesh Banjare has already been released on bail by order dated 17.12.2015 passed by co-ordinate bench of this Court in M.Cr.C. No.7089/2015 and applicant has not misused the liberty of bail as granted to him earlier and, therefore, he may be enlarged on bail. (4) On the other hand, counsel for the State opposes the bail application.
(5) Taking into consideration the facts and circumstances of the case; further considering the fact that applicant was earlier granted bail by the trial Court and he has not misused the liberty of bail as granted to him earlier; also considering his pre trial detention and the fact that similarly situated co-accused has already been released on bail; and the charge sheet has already been filed; this Court is of the view that it is a fit case to release the applicant on bail. Accordingly, the bail application is allowed. (6) Accused/applicant - Mukesh @ Gola Tandan is directed to be released on bail on his executing a personal bond in the sum of Rs.25,000/- with one surety in the like sum to the satisfaction of the trial Court. He is directed to appear before the trial Court on each and every date given to him by the said Court till disposal of the trial.
